Coordinator, Peoples Democratic Party, PDP, South-South Youth Vanguard, Mr. Bekes Akpere, has lauded President Goodluck Jonathan for the re-appointment of Mrs Diezani Allison-Madueke to head the Petroleum Ministry.
He described her as a square peg in a square hole.
Akpere in a statement in Warri, Delta State, yesterday, said Diezani, during her stay at the ministry in the last dispensation, initiated several reforms, which had repositioned the Petroleum Industry in line with international best practices.
The group noted that Diezani brought her experiences from the oil industry to bear on the Ministry, adding that she gave a good account of herself during the Senate screening.
Akpere urged her to carry her reforms in the petroleum sector to the letter, as Nigerians would be better for it and be open to suggestions to enable her succeed in line with Mr. president’s transformation agenda.
He said her reforms were geared towards job creation, local content development, and availability of petroleum products across the country.
